Insider Tips For The Smartest Website Hosting

TIP! Many web providers offer a myriad of add-ons to their services, but some of these features usually change from host to host. Make sure you are comparing apples to apples by selecting plans which are similar.

A web page hosting provider is the bridge that allows people using the Internet to view your website. There are several important factors to take into consideration when selecting a provider. This article has advice to follow when looking for a service.

TIP! When you are deciding on who to choose for web hosting, pick a company that resides where your target audience is located. For example, if your target market resides within Germany, it is in your best interest to select a provider that operates a data center from within the country’s borders.

Trying to choose between dedicated and shared hosting? If this is your first website and it’s relatively small, a virtual shared server is probably good for now. If you’re moving a large website which already gets thousands or millions of views, shared probably won’t cut it. You may be better off with dedicated hosting.

TIP! Are you considering utilizing a web host that is free for the website you are starting? Back up everything on your site, since many free hosts don’t have backup services. You get exactly what you have paid for in this case.

The amount that web hosts charge for service packages depends upon how much traffic your site receives. Find out if your host will bill you a flat rate plus overage for greater traffic, or if they bill you in steps.

Free web hosts are available if you’re looking to save money. Your site is displayed with ads, and you have limited space to store it. On the other hand, commercial or security-sensitive sites are best left to paid website hosting.

TIP! Thoroughly research hosting companies you are considering. You want to find customer reviews so that you have an indicator of how reliable this host is before you invest into them.

Do not go with a free web host just because the service is free. Free hosts pay for themselves in several ways, including adding banner ads and other distractions to your site. The hosting company, not you, chooses the ads and ad categories to display. Also, these random ads placed on your site give it an unprofessional look and feel.

TIP! If your computer is reliant upon just a dial-up connection for Internet, don’t host your own site. In order to make sure your site stays updated and accessible to users, it is essential that it is supported by a dependable and fast connection method.

Many web hosting companies are resellers for major hosting companies. They buy a large hosting account, and then hand out smaller pieces of it to other companies for a monthly fee. Find out the company that will ultimately host your site so you can get the best price.

TIP! First, check out the hosts history. Be sure that the company has been around for a long time and has a reputable history.

Look for web hosts that give a cPanel. A cPanel allows you to add common applications to your site easily. The user interface is intuitive and easy to use for application installations. In addition, it will help you manage your website more efficiently.

Make sure the web host you choose offers support for every programming language used by your website, as well as any you may end up using in the future. Unless your provider can support the most popular languages, it will be impossible to get the most from your website. Furthermore, if you choose to switch to a different programming language further down the road, your provider may not be capable of accommodating your site. Switching web hosts can be difficult.
